WSMAN_DATA structure

Contains inbound and outbound data used in the Windows Remote Management (WinRM) API.

Syntax


typedef struct _WSMAN_DATA {
  WSManDataType type;
  union {
    WSMAN_DATA_TEXT   text;
    WSMAN_DATA_BINARY binaryData;
    DWORD             number;
  };
} WSMAN_DATA;

Members

type

Specifies the type of data currently stored in the union.

( unnamed union )

Contains the data.

text

If type is WSMAN_DATA_TYPE_TEXT, text contains a WSMAN_DATA_TEXT structure.

binaryData

If type is WSMAN_DATA_TYPE_XML_BINARY, binaryData contains a WSMAN_DATA_BINARY structure.

number

If type is WSMAN_DATA_TYPE_DWORD, number is a DWORD integer.

Requirements

Minimum supported client

Windows 7

Minimum supported server

Windows Server 2008 R2

Redistributable

Windows Management Framework on Windows Server 2008 with SP2, Windows Server 2003 with SP2, Windows Vista with SP1, and Windows Vista with SP2

Header

Wsman.h

 

 

Show:
© 2014 Microsoft